
Unveiling the Takeuchi TL11R3: A New Era in Compact Track Loaders
In the intricate world of construction machinery, the Takeuchi TL11R3 stands out as an innovative powerhouse. The company’s first compact track loader featuring electric-over-hydraulic controls, the TL11R3 promises enhanced performance for contractors and equipment operators alike.
What Makes the TL11R3 Stand Out?
With a robust weight of 11,650 pounds and a horsepower rating of 107.3, the TL11R3 is a marvel of engineering. Its rated operating capacity of 2,735 pounds allows operators to tackle a range of challenging tasks, from grading to landscaping and site preparation. Equipped with both standard and high-flow configurations delivering up to 40.5 gallons per minute hydraulic flow, the TL11R3 boasts compatibility with a variety of attachments, including snowblowers, cold planers, and forestry drum mulchers. This versatility is essential in maximizing job site efficiency.
Innovative Features of the TL11R3
The design and technology behind the TL11R3 bring significant advancements that redefine operator experience. The redesigned cab is an inviting space featuring an 8-inch touchscreen monitor for easy navigation and control. Additionally, the password-protected keyless start and a six-way adjustable suspension seat cater to the modern operator's desire for comfort and security. Adjustable joystick controls further tailor the machine's operation to specific user preferences, making it not just a piece of equipment, but a personal tool for productivity.
The Power Behind the Machine: Breakout Forces
The TL11R3's radial-lift boom design offers impressive breakout forces, with an astounding 7,958 pounds of bucket breakout force and 7,126 pounds of lift arm breakout force. These figures illustrate the loader's capability to handle demanding tasks such as heavy lifting and dirt moving, ensuring contractors can rely on its performance under pressure.
Enhanced Maintenance and Fleet Management
Modern construction demands efficient equipment management, and the TL11R3 excels in this area with simplified daily maintenance points. Coupled with five years of standard Takeuchi Fleet Management telematics, operators can enjoy remote diagnostics, track utilization, and plan maintenance effectively.
